【php在web开发中如何使用】教程文章相关的互联网学习教程文章

php-为Web开发人员设计测试

我需要为Web开发人员设计一个测试.此测试应筛选并很好地掌握DOM,并且在设计可扩展且高效的数据库和服务器端代码方面具有良好的技能,并且会因Web特定问题(例如,从一种编码转换为另一种编码,干净的输入安全性)而使问题更加棘手.最棒的是,将其放入3个小时.解决方法:听起来您已经完全知道要对开发人员进行测试的内容了……为什么不让他创建一个包含您已经提出的一些想法的小型网站.但是,在3小时内您不可能获得任何开发人员的全部经验. ...

如何加载测试PHP Web论坛软件?

我注意到那里有很多PHP论坛程序包-http://en.wikipedia.org/wiki/Comparison_of_Internet_forum_software_(PHP).我特别想寻找一个扩展性强的论坛程序包-从我听到的两个最受欢迎的论坛程序包Vbulletin和Simple Machines的需求中,他们所需要的功能远远超出了人们的想象. 在Googlin’几个小时之后,我无法找到论坛性能的任何比较,因此我正在考虑自己做一个.问题是-从哪里开始?最好的方法是对不同的PHP论坛包进行负载测试?解决方法:您...

php-为Web应用程序分发和使用API​​密钥【代码】

我有一个Web应用程序,正在为其构建一个Drupal模块,该模块允许我的客户访问我的应用程序上的某些数据. 我打算将秘密的API密钥分发给需要在其Drupal模块副本中输入该值的客户.然后,这个Drupal模块与我的Web应用程序进行对话,但是我需要确保POST请求确实来自该来源. 如何使用此“秘密密钥”传递一些信息,以便当我的应用程序收到它时,它将知道:(a) its from that client's server. (b) it hasnt been eavesdropped on / copied and us...

php-从Web应用程序打印多个上传的文档

我想知道是否有可能从对象打印所有附加的pdf.(恐怕不是,但是最好问一下; D) 上下文: 用户在其帐户中上传了多个pdf文件,然后,他单击“打印所有pdf附件”,而不是下载,然后一一点击“打印” 谢谢.解决方法:仅通过JS或结合使用PHP和js(也许可以由PHP调用的服务器端程序),您可以通过多种方式进行此操作: >使目标文档为php文件,该文件以编程方式将所有PDF合并为一个文档(例如,使用pdftk),然后输出带有PDF标头的合并文件.该文件将被加载...

php-为基于Web的应用程序实现自动提醒电子邮件功能【代码】

我想为我的Web应用程序创建一个功能,一旦用户输入我的数据库,每4周就会向他们发送一封电子邮件,提醒他们例如提供一些反馈.我听说cron工作是我要寻找的,但我想知道那里还有什么,也许存在一个php脚本或一种简单的方法? 我希望从他们进入数据库开始倒数直到4周过去,然后调用php文件或向我发送自己选择的电子邮件的东西,这样的倒数计时.如果可能的话让我知道!谢谢解决方法:我想说的是使用cron作业(它可以每天在某个特定时间运行,这很...

php-基于Web的项目管理和计时软件?

我在一家网上商店工作,而我们大多数人都不是程序员. (我是.)结构几乎不存在.最大的美丽主义建筑正在记录我们的时间,因为这对企业至关重要.我们中的一些人是项目经理,但每个人都有自己的系统.现在,最近客户希望对我们的所有工作进行估算,并且将账单与已完成的工作进行核对是一场噩梦.我们需要一种更好的组织方式. 我希望使用基于Web的开放源代码工具,我们可以使用它来管理客户,项目,列出时间,并允许项目经理将任务分配给我们的开发人...

php-Web应用程序翻译的另一种方法【代码】

我已经完成了一些网站和应用程序,它们支持多种语言,其中我在代码中使用了语言xml文件和关键字.对于我的Web应用程序,我相信这种方法很烂.我喜欢阅读和理解我的HTML代码.这段代码没有任何意义:<h1><?= translate('main_headline'); ?></h1>它一开始看起来不错,但最终让不满意的程序员告终,因为添加新功能的过程现在需要始终将内容放入XML中. 我的解决方案(一个小时前我刚刚编写了一个简单的测试PHP解析器,您认为这可以用于大型项目吗...

如何在使用Boost C编写的php Web应用程序中读取地图(在共享区域中)?【代码】

我已经在共享区域中使用C,Boost库编写了一张地图(键,值).void CreateIndexMap() {shared_memory_object::remove(Getsharedmemoryregion());managed_shared_memory segment(create_only,Getsharedmemoryregion(), 10000000);void_allocator alloc_inst (segment.get_segment_manager());complex_map_type *mymap = segment.construct<complex_map_type>("MyMap")(std::less<char_string>(), alloc_inst); }在共享区域中...

php – 在Web根目录外存储脚本文件

为了保护带有敏感信息的php文件(如数据库连接和登录信息)的具体原因,我已经看到建议将部分或全部php包含文件存储在Web文档根目录(我的情况下为username / public_html)之外的某些地方.如果Web服务器打嗝并停止保护php文件,那么它们对于知道在哪里看的外人来说是“可见的”. 对我来说这似乎有些偏执,但我猜这些人之前已经被严重烧伤所以我愿意继续这样做.该建议通常采用包含文件的形式,例如“../include_files/”,因此它不直接在文档...

php – Web数据的大型机器学习

如果我想使用太大而不适合内存的矩阵来进行大量数据拟合,我会研究哪些工具/库?具体来说,如果我通常使用php mysql运行来自网站的数据,你会建议如何制作一个可以在合理的时间内运行大型矩阵运算的离线流程? 可能的答案可能是“你应该使用这种语言与这些分布式矩阵算法在许多机器上映射reduce”.我认为php不是最好的语言,因此流程更像是其他一些离线进程从数据库中读取数据,进行学习,并以php可以在以后使用的格式存储规则(因为该网站...

php – Web应用程序开发 – 什么是文档最佳实践

我正在使用HTML,PHP,jQuery和MySQL构建一个用于学习目的的Web应用程序.随着我的应用越来越大,并且越来越多的互动,我开始变得困惑和凌乱.因此,我想知道记录Web应用程序的最佳实践是什么:方法,软件等.解决方法:在所有类和方法中使用严格的PHPDoc块,然后使用Reflection即时创建文档.

php – Web根目录中Mediawiki安装的简短URL【代码】

我在我的Web根目录上运行了Mediawiki安装.例如.主页面可以通过访问http://example.com/index.php?title=Main_Page我想改变它,以便短URLhttp://example.com/Main_Page我的配置如下#.htaccess Options +FollowSymLinks RewriteEngine On RewriteRule ^(.*)$/index.php?title=$1 [PT,L,QSA] RewriteRule ^.*$/index.php [L,QSA].// LocalSettings.php $wgScriptPath = ".."; $wgArticlePath = "/$1"; $wgUsePathInfo = true;但是这个配...

php – 基于Web的应用程序中XML的用途是什么?

我想知道是否有必要在社交网站中使用XML进行大型网络项目? 目前我只是在普通的PHP和HTML文件中编码.如果我使用XML文件会提供任何便利,比如提高文档的处理速度或减少编码权重? 我现在不懂XML,还告诉它与HTML有太大不同吗?解决方法:HTML具有固定的标签集,其中包含定义的含义,主要与表示有关,在XML中,您可以定义自己的标签集,其中包含特定于您的应用程序或域的含义. 您可能不需要XML来开始构建您的社交网站,但在此之后,您可以使用它...

是否可以在Azure上包含用于PHP Web App的web.config文件(或等效文件)?【代码】

我正在尝试将对PHP站点的访问限制为特定的IP地址,但我见过的唯一一个使用web.config文件的type of documentation.我知道web.config通常用于ASP.NET项目,但不知道我们是否应该能够将它包含在PHP项目中的某个地方.我已尝试在我的Web根目录中包含一个名为web.config的空文件,但由于发生了内部服务器错误,因此无法显示该页面.请求站点时显示为页面. 是否有适当的地方将其粘贴在我的目录中,一种特定的配置方式,或者我可以包含的某个类型...

php – Web App:可以监控HTTP文件下载的任何方式【代码】

我正在开发一个Web应用程序.它将允许用户通过HTTP协议从服务器下载文件.这些文件最大可达4 GB. 这些是我的要求和限制: > HTTP文件下载进度%> HTTP文件下载完成后注册>注册,如果HTTP文件下载崩溃>注册,如果用户取消了下载>恢复未完成的文件下载>能够下载高达4GB的文件>应该只在客户端实现JavaScript / HTML5,在服务器上实现PHP.>可能无法在客户端使用Java或Flash实现. 我的发展环境: > Apache> PHP> MySQL> Windows 7 我的问题是...